要用编程来创作古诗词背景,你可以遵循以下步骤:
文本处理
读取或获取古诗的文本数据,这可以通过读取文本文件或从网络上爬取实现。
对文本进行预处理,包括分词、去除停用词等,以便于后续分析。
特征提取
从古诗文本中提取有用的特征,如词袋模型、TF-IDF、word2vec等,将文字转换为计算机能够处理的数值形式。
模型训练
利用机器学习或深度学习算法,如朴素贝叶斯、支持向量机、RNN、LSTM等,训练一个模型来识别和学习古诗的规律和模式。
生成古诗
使用训练好的模型,通过输入一些初始词语或句子,预测并生成新的诗句,不断迭代直至满足长度或结束符的要求。
评估和优化
通过语法正确性、韵律和意境等评估指标来评价生成的古诗质量。
根据评估结果调整模型参数或增加训练数据,以优化生成结果。
此外,如果你只是想展示如何用编程生成一首简单的古诗,可以使用一些现成的代码模板,例如:
```html
这里写上古诗的内容。